硝虫噻嗪
(2E)-2-(nitromethylidene)-1,3-thiazinane
Also Known As: Nithiazine, Nithiazine [ISO], (+-)-Nithiazine, (E)-Nithiazine, TTNM
| Molecular Formula | C5H8N2O2S |
|---|---|
| Molecular Weight | 160.03 g/mol |
| LogP | 0.7885 |
| Topological Polar Surface Area | 55.17 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 4 |
| Rotatable Bonds | 1 |
| Exact Mass | 160.03065 |
| Heavy Atoms | 10 |
| Complexity | 161.03088 |
Chemical Identifiers
| CAS Number | 97190-65-3 |
|---|---|
| SMILES | C1CN/C(=C\[N+](=O)[O-])/SC1 |

Chemical Property Profile of 硝虫噻嗪
Property Insights of 硝虫噻嗪
The XLogP value of 0.7885 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 硝虫噻嗪. With a topological polar surface area (TPSA) of 55.17 Ų, 硝虫噻嗪 ex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 硝虫噻嗪 has 1 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
